Management Meeting Minutes — Customer Concentration

Attendees: heads of department, chaired by M. Calloway.

Main topic: Tarnwell Logistics now accounts for nearly half of Vexbridge Fabrication's revenue — everyone agreed that's too many eggs in one basket. Sales will push the mid-market pipeline in the Averley corridor, and ops will model a scenario where the Tarnwell volume drops by a third. Update due at next month's session. The confidential note on our business plans follows below.

internal memo for yahag-tahog: The pricing group signed off on a budget of $152.8 million for Project Soriel.

## Service Accounts: Billing Worker Deploys

Blue-green deploys of the Tallyhawk billing worker run under a dedicated service account with deploy-only scope. The account cannot read billing records; it only flips traffic between the blue and green stacks via the Crossgate controller. Rotation happens quarterly. Reviewers auditing deploy history can query Crossgate directly using the read-only credential issued below.

app token of yajeg-kawef = kto11_7En3XSX8xQw

Handing off Gridwright to Petra before I rotate onto the Lanternfall team. Quick notes for review: the clue-ranking pass is new and untested against themed puzzles; check the scoring weights in rank.py. Grid fill uses backtracking with a word-list cache that invalidates on dictionary updates — known slow path, tracked in the backlog. Symmetry validation was rewritten last sprint; diff it carefully. Test fixtures and the architecture write-up are on the internal wiki page below.

wiki page, bawef-hafop: https://jira.nelvroworks.corp/job/pages/projects/7c5c0f440dbd

## Authentication

The Vigilqueue proctoring worker pulls exam sessions from the Hallward broker. Auth is a static bearer key, rotated monthly by the Lockspan job. Scope: dequeue and ack only. No student data access. Set it in `VIGIL_KEY` before starting the worker. For local development against the staging broker, use the key below.

service key, fawip-bajef: kto11_Qt5wZK9vdNC

## Support

Reviewing a Flagship rollout change? The percentage-bucketing math lives in `bucketer.go` and is deliberately boring — if it looks clever, that's a red flag. Config mistakes are the usual culprit, not the framework. Check the rollout-guardrails doc first, and if you're still stuck, the Flagship maintainers are happy to help at the address below.

escalation mailbox, fawif-yageg: wenmir@qorvelworks.corp